Ordinals
beta
Sat 1321910948156967
decimal
318764.948156967
degree
0°108764′236″948156967‴
percentile
62.948140457669986%
name
emgyxbbdjxq
cycle
0
epoch
1
period
158
block
318764
offset
948156967
timestamp
2014-09-02 15:32:41 UTC
rarity
common
prev
next